In this review of the adidas CrazyChaos 2000 sneaker, the bottom line is clear: these are a comfortable, lightweight everyday running shoe best for casual runners and daily wear. Built with a synthetic and textile upper and a Cloudfoam midsole, the shoe prioritizes step-in comfort and breathability above aggressive performance features. The review finds them ideal for logging daily miles, commuting on foot, or as a stylish street shoe, while noting mixed reports about cushioning on long runs and occasional fit variability among buyers.
Key Features
- Lightweight upper: The synthetic and textile construction keeps weight down while providing durable coverage for daily use.
- Breathable mesh: A ventilated textile upper helps feet stay cooler during city runs or long days on foot.
- Cloudfoam midsole: The cushioned midsole offers soft, responsive underfoot comfort for everyday mileage and casual wear.
- Textile lining: A soft textile lining improves overall comfort and reduces friction during extended wear.
- Rubber outsole: The rubber outsole delivers reliable grip and a low-profile look suitable for pavement and sidewalks.
Who It's For
The CrazyChaos 2000 is geared toward men who want a lightweight, comfortable shoe for daily runs, walking commutes, and casual outfits. It works well for people who value cushioning and breathable materials in a shoe that transitions easily from exercise to everyday life.
Serious road racers or runners needing aggressive stability and high-mileage support should look elsewhere, as some customers report mixed cushioning feedback on long runs and occasional blistering for extended high-intensity sessions.

Our Verdict
The adidas CrazyChaos 2000 is a solid choice for men seeking a comfortable, lightweight runner for daily miles and casual wear; its Cloudfoam midsole and breathable textile upper deliver good value for everyday use, though runners planning long, intense sessions should test fit and cushioning first.
Frequently Asked Questions
Are these shoes comfortable for daily walking?
Yes, most customers report the Cloudfoam midsole and soft textile lining make them comfortable for daily walking and commuting.
Do they run true to size?
Customers disagree on sizing, so it is recommended to try them on or check the store sizing guidance before purchasing.
Are they suitable for long road runs?
They work for casual runs, but some users reported cushioning issues or blisters during longer, high-intensity runs, so serious runners may prefer a dedicated long-distance trainer.
